Jimmy R. Franklin, 67, of New Richmond, died at 4:30 p.m. Thursday, Jan. 5, 2012, at Seton Specialty Hospital, Lafayette.

Born Sept. 4, 1944, in Barren County, Ky., he was the son of Helen Frances Stinson Franklin and the late Guy T. Franklin. He was a graduate of Coal Creek Central High School.

On May 12, 1973, he married Louan Jenkinson, and she survives.

Mr. Franklin retired from Raybestos Products Inc. after 40 years where he worked in production set-up.

He was a member of New Richmond Christian Church, Wabash Club, Senior Bowling League of Crawfordsville, Linden Conservation Club and Hilltop Archery Club, attending the Royal Archer Competition in New York. Mr. Franklin was also an assistant Boy Scout Leader and a volunteer with the Special Olympics. He was an avid fisherman, loved being outdoors and loved to hunt mushrooms.

Surviving are his wife, Louan Franklin of New Richmond; mother, Helen Franklin of Lebanon, Tenn.; son, James Clayton Franklin (wife: Jody) of Darlington; daughter, Tammy Franklin of Lafayette; brother, Richard Franklin (wife: Shirley) of Hayworth, Ill.; sister, Pat Gross of Lebanon, Tenn.; special cousin, David "Short" Short (wife: Sue) of New Richmond; and 6 grandchildren.
